
Bellwether at Toledo Spirits is our cocktail bar and kitchen created to showcase our spirits in exciting, inventive cocktails.
Our team carefully combines flavors from around the world to craft delicious and unique drinks. The relaxed atmosphere is perfect for date night, business meetings, private events, or group get-togethers.

Our Space is Rich with Toledo History












Our space is rich with Toledo history, but designed with all the modern, comfortable appointments you would expect in a craft cocktail bar.

Try one of our seasonal signatures, classic cocktails, or sip on a glass of wine or canned beer.
Grab a dip, spread, or snack from our food menu for a perfect pairing after work or during a night out.
Stop in to experience Bellwether for yourself
Bellwether offers private cocktail classes, public tastings and tours at 2:00 and 4:00 on Saturdays and Sundays.
We also have a fully stocked Bottle Shop where you can purchase a bottle of Toledo Spirits to take home.
